A Total Guide to Roofing Providers: Essential Installation Strategies, Repair Solutions, and Ongoing Maintenance A complete understanding of roofing solutions is critical for home owners. It incorporates different aspects, from choosing appropriate products to implementing reliable installment methods. Repair remedies additionally play an essential role in maintaining a roofing's stab... https://deaniexqg.wikibestproducts.com/1972693/how_roof_maintenance_moreno_valley_helps_stop_costly_major_repairs